Introduction to Coffee and its Skin Benefits

Coffee is high in antioxidants and caffeic acid. It exfoliates, nourishes, and brightens the skin and helps slow aging. Caffeine is a vasoconstrictor. It means caffeine constricts blood vessels to reduce inflammation. Additionally, it helps improve blood circulation. Here are some more ways in which coffee benefits the skin.

Benefits of Coffee Face Mask for Face Pigmentation

Coffee is as refreshing for your skin as it is for your mood. Here are some ways in which coffee can benefit pigmentation.

Benefits of Coffee Face Mask for Face Pigmentation

  • Increased Skin Elasticity

A coffee face pack can reduce fine lines and wrinkles. It helps significantly curtail photoaging effects and increase the skin’s elasticity.

  • Soothing Effect

Scrubbing coffee grounds can help remove dead skin cells and unclog pores. Coffee contains chlorogenic acids that reduce inflammation and safeguard the skin against strains of bacteria. Thus, it indeed has a soothing effect on the skin.

  • Discoloration Treatment

Coffee has exfoliation properties that help lower skin pigmentation and dark spots. Additionally, it can help treat the appearance of sunspots and redness.

  • Restoring UV Skin Damage

Coffee contains antioxidants that help neutralize free radicals due to UV rays that irritate the skin and cause redness. While soothing the skin, it can protect it from UV rays.

Coffee Pack for Pigmentation

Now, let’s see how to apply coffee to the face. You can do so in various ways, depending on the problem you look forward to treating. 

  • Tan Removal

Take one tablespoon of coffee powder and one tablespoon of lemon juice in a bowl. Stir the mixture until it becomes lump-free. Apply it to the face and neck. Rinse the pack after about 12-15 minutes and pat the face dry. Do it twice a week.

  • Skin Whitening

One tablespoon of coffee powder and mixing it with half a tablespoon of raw milk can help whiten the skin. All you have to do is stir the mixture until you achieve grain consistency. Cleanse your face and neck gently and apply the face pack. Keep it for around 12-15 minutes, and wash it off with cold water. Do the process twice a week.

  • Pimples

Take one tablespoon of coffee powder, approximately 1/4th teaspoon of cinnamon powder, and half a tablespoon of coconut oil. Mix it and stir the concoction to form a consistent paste. Apply the mixture to your face and wash it after 18-20 minutes. Do the process once a week for effective results.

Side Effects of Applying Coffee on the Face

Coffee is beneficial for your skin. But avoid overusing it. The first thing to do is consult a dermatologist to know if coffee suits your skin. Besides, you must be particularly careful while using coffee scrubs. It is because over-scrubbing can result in breakouts. Also, people with sensitive skin should limit exfoliation to only once a week.

Another vital factor is that caffeine increases the body’s stress response. It can release higher amounts of hormones like cortisol, resulting in excess oil or sebum production and causing breakouts.
